------------------------------------------------------------------------ The pst-optexp package --- Sketching optical experimental setups Maintained by Christoph Bersch E-mail: usenet@bersch.net Released under the LaTeX Project Public License v1.3c or later See http://www.latex-project.org/lppl.txt ------------------------------------------------------------------------ The package pst-optexp is a collection of optical components that facilitate easy sketching of optical experimental setups. A lot of different free-ray and fiber components are provided, which alignment, positioning and labelling can be achieved in very simple and flexible ways. The components can be connected with fibers or beams, realistic raytraced beam paths are also possible. Installation ------------ The package is supplied in dtx format and as a pre-extracted zip file, pst-optexp.tds.zip. The later is most convenient for most users: simply unzip this in your local texmf directory and run texhash to update the database of file locations. The pst-optexp package is also contained in MiKTeX and TeX Live distributions. If you want to unpack the dtx yourself you must run "tex pst-optexp.ins", to typeset the documentation run "latex pst-optexp.dtx". The package requires recent version of pst-node, multido, pstricks-add, pst-eucl, and environ.
